Output 888175654c34cff60eb1e69734c830501ce39a499fda9b572d03f46dcb252092:17

value
20283880
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7da3dc9f26f2af520e8a89696d03a5019e0ffedb OP_EQUALVERIFY OP_CHECKSIG
address
1CTKmJCSnM54tPToEi1igWM422EWnKos3u
transaction
888175654c34cff60eb1e69734c830501ce39a499fda9b572d03f46dcb252092
spent
true